MFEM  v4.6.0
Finite element discretization library
Public Member Functions | Public Attributes | Protected Attributes | List of all members
mfem::GnuTLS_session_params Class Reference

#include <socketstream.hpp>

Collaboration diagram for mfem::GnuTLS_session_params:
[legend]

Public Member Functions

 GnuTLS_session_params (GnuTLS_global_state &state, const char *pubkey_file, const char *privkey_file, const char *trustedkeys_file, unsigned int flags)
 
 ~GnuTLS_session_params ()
 
gnutls_certificate_credentials_t get_cred () const
 
unsigned int get_flags () const
 

Public Attributes

GnuTLS_global_statestate
 
GnuTLS_status status
 

Protected Attributes

gnutls_certificate_credentials_t my_cred
 
unsigned int my_flags
 

Detailed Description

Definition at line 140 of file socketstream.hpp.

Constructor & Destructor Documentation

◆ GnuTLS_session_params()

mfem::GnuTLS_session_params::GnuTLS_session_params ( GnuTLS_global_state state,
const char *  pubkey_file,
const char *  privkey_file,
const char *  trustedkeys_file,
unsigned int  flags 
)

Definition at line 466 of file socketstream.cpp.

◆ ~GnuTLS_session_params()

mfem::GnuTLS_session_params::~GnuTLS_session_params ( )
inline

Definition at line 155 of file socketstream.hpp.

Member Function Documentation

◆ get_cred()

gnutls_certificate_credentials_t mfem::GnuTLS_session_params::get_cred ( ) const
inline

Definition at line 160 of file socketstream.hpp.

◆ get_flags()

unsigned int mfem::GnuTLS_session_params::get_flags ( ) const
inline

Definition at line 161 of file socketstream.hpp.

Member Data Documentation

◆ my_cred

gnutls_certificate_credentials_t mfem::GnuTLS_session_params::my_cred
protected

Definition at line 143 of file socketstream.hpp.

◆ my_flags

unsigned int mfem::GnuTLS_session_params::my_flags
protected

Definition at line 144 of file socketstream.hpp.

◆ state

GnuTLS_global_state& mfem::GnuTLS_session_params::state

Definition at line 147 of file socketstream.hpp.

◆ status

GnuTLS_status mfem::GnuTLS_session_params::status

Definition at line 148 of file socketstream.hpp.


The documentation for this class was generated from the following files: